From 692192be92c97250fa2af2fa195feee677265537 Mon Sep 17 00:00:00 2001 From: vlad Date: Mon, 13 Mar 2017 22:23:17 -0700 Subject: Added writing tracking Id to MDC so it can be logged for all messages, removed some linkerd legacy and refined Revision equals --- src/main/scala/xyz/driver/core/app.scala |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/main/scala/xyz/driver/core/app.scala b/src/main/scala/xyz/driver/core/app.scala index 090be76..b53cc7b 100644 --- a/src/main/scala/xyz/driver/core/app.scala +++ b/src/main/scala/xyz/driver/core/app.scala @@ -70,8 +70,8 @@ object app { val _ = Future { http.bindAndHandle(route2HandlerFlow(handleExceptions(ExceptionHandler(exceptionHandler)) { ctx => val trackingId = rest.extractTrackingId(ctx.request) - log.audit(s"Received request ${ctx.request} with tracking id $trackingId") MDC.put("trackingId", trackingId) + log.audit(s"Received request ${ctx.request} with tracking id $trackingId") val contextWithTrackingId = ctx.withRequest(ctx.request.addHeader(RawHeader(ContextHeaders.TrackingIdHeader, trackingId))) -- cgit v1.2.3